    $8K at CarMax is a tough price point. $12K is about the lowest thing in their inventory for a PU and that is for something like a Ford Ranger. For what it is worth about CarMax, last month I was in the market for a late model Highlander for my wife and I found their cars to be comparable to models at Toyota dealers. Given the CarMax no-haggle selling policy, I would estimate their prices to be about 10% higher than other independent dealers. The salesman was very professional and their show room/lot was first rate.

    I suggest the kids look thru cars.com and iSeeCars.com (gives a history of how long a car has been for sale and traces VIN sales history). Many dealers now offer free CarFaxes and this can be used to avoid rustbelt auction and wrecked vehicles.

    The kids may also need to consider altering their search criteria for something like a Camary or Accord if the PU route fails to result in something suitable. Hope this helps.
